Where to start
If you are setting the lab up for the first time, build the equipment tree first — everything else keys off channels. Once channels exist, the Lab view becomes useful, and the test scheduler can place requests onto real hardware. Recording equipment is optional. Measurements work fine without achannel_id,
so if you have a single cycler you can skip Operate entirely and use the
free-text test_setup fields instead.
